
Former President Donald Trump blamed the Monday stock market dive on Vice President Kamala Harris in a series of Truth Social posts.
The market experienced a worldwide sell-off on Monday that hit American stocks as concerns over a possible U.S. recession take hold, Fox Business reported. Trump took to Truth Social to attribute the downturn to Harris being âeven worseâ than President Joe Biden, predicting an economic depression in 2024.
âOf course there is a massive market downturn. Kamala is even worse than Crooked Joe. Markets will NEVER accept the Radical Left Lunatic that DESTROYED San Francisco and California, as a whole,â Trump posted. âNext move, THE GREAT DEPRESSION OF 2024! You canât play games with MARKETS. KAMALA CRASH!!!â
The Dow Jones Industrial Average plunged 1,000 points on Monday, according to Fox Business.
Trump separately posted that he will bring âPROSPERITYâ and peace if reelected, in contrast to Harris. Harrisâ campaign X account has yet to address the downturn, as of this writing.
Former Federal Reserve economist Claudia Sahm, who established the âSahm Rule,â which has accurately predicted past recessions, warned about the economyâs worrisome trajectory following a dismal jobs report on Friday.
The âSahm Ruleâ is a sign of the beginning of a recession and takes place when the three-month unemployment rate average jumps by 0.5% or more compared to the lowest three-month average from the past year, according to the Federal Reserve Bank of St. Louis. Sahm on âBloomberg Surveillanceâ responded âit triggeredâ when host Tom Keen asked if âthe Sahm rule is in force at this moment,â based on the jobs report data.
